I am a lifelong resident of Ocean County, New Jersey and have been a professional fishing guide for the past ten years. I have been an intense and avid salt-water fisherman for over thirty years. Both of my boats are especially well suited for fly-fishing. In our local waters we are able to catch large striped bass, bluefish, weakfish, fluke, albacore, bonita, spanish mackerel, and a variety of different tuna. As your charter-fishing guide I will also tailor fit our itinerary to target any specific salt-water species that are within our range and season if you desire. Whether it is live-lining bait or enticing them with a custom tied fly, I well do what it takes to put us on the bite. Crappie
For crappie fishing near Highland Park, explore the local ponds and lakes. Weston Mill Pond and other smaller impoundments in the area can provide good crappie action. Spring is the prime time, as crappie move into shallow water to spawn. Look for them around submerged brush, docks, and lily pads. Small jigs and minnows suspended under a bobber are effective techniques. Early morning and late afternoon are typically the best times to fish for crappie. Some local parks offer bank fishing access. Be sure to check local regulations regarding size and creel limits. Crappie populations can fluctuate, so it's helpful to scout different locations to find where the fish are concentrated. Also, remember that crappie are schooling fish, so if you catch one, there are likely more nearby. A fish finder can be helpful in locating schools of crappie in deeper water.

Frequently Asked Questions
What's the best bait for catching Crappie around Highland Park?
Crappie in the Highland Park area are often caught using small minnows or jigs. Try fishing around submerged structures or near docks for the best results.
When is the best time of year to fish for Crappie in Highland Park?
Crappie fishing is generally good year-round, but spring and fall are often the most productive times. During these seasons, Crappie tend to be more active and closer to shore.
What is the daily limit for Crappie in New Jersey?
In New Jersey, you're allowed to keep up to 10 Crappie per day.
Are there any size restrictions for Crappie in New Jersey?
No, there is no minimum size limit for Crappie in New Jersey. You can keep any Crappie you catch, provided you adhere to the daily bag limit.
